Windows MySQL 数据存放位置
MySQL 是一种流行的开源关系型数据库管理系统,广泛应用于各种应用程序和网站开发中。在 Windows 系统上,MySQL 的数据存放位置是一个重要的概念,它决定了数据库文件的存储路径和文件名。本文将介绍 Windows 系统下 MySQL 数据存放位置的相关知识,并附带代码示例。
MySQL 数据存放位置
在 Windows 系统上,MySQL 数据存放位置主要包括两个方面:数据文件存放路径和日志文件存放路径。
数据文件存放路径
MySQL 数据文件是指数据库中存储的实际数据,通常以文件的形式存储在磁盘上。在 Windows 系统上,默认情况下,MySQL 数据文件存放在 "C:\ProgramData\MySQL\MySQL Server x.x\Data" 目录下,其中 x.x 表示 MySQL 的版本号。
日志文件存放路径
MySQL 日志文件主要用于记录数据库的操作日志和错误日志。在 Windows 系统上,默认情况下,MySQL 日志文件存放在 "C:\ProgramData\MySQL\MySQL Server x.x\Data" 目录下,与数据文件存放在同一个目录下。
修改数据存放位置
如果默认的数据存放位置不符合需求,可以通过修改 MySQL 的配置文件来指定自定义的数据存放路径。
步骤 1:找到 MySQL 配置文件
MySQL 的配置文件名为 "my.ini",可以在 MySQL 的安装目录下找到。通常,MySQL 的安装目录为 "C:\Program Files\MySQL\MySQL Server x.x"。
步骤 2:修改配置文件
使用文本编辑器打开 "my.ini" 文件,并找到以下两行配置:
datadir=C:/ProgramData/MySQL/MySQL Server x.x/Data
log-error=C:/ProgramData/MySQL/MySQL Server x.x/Data/error.log
将上述路径改为自定义的存放路径,例如:
datadir=D:/MySQL/Data
log-error=D:/MySQL/Data/error.log
步骤 3:重启 MySQL 服务
保存修改后的配置文件,并重启 MySQL 服务,使配置生效。
示例:修改数据存放位置
下面是一个示例,演示如何通过修改 MySQL 配置文件来修改数据存放位置。
## MySQL 数据存放位置示例
下面是一个使用 MySQL 存放数据的示例表格:
| ID | Name |
|----|-------|
| 1 | Alice |
| 2 | Bob |
| 3 | Carol |
## 数据存放位置关系图
``` mermaid
erDiagram
ENTITY "Data" {
+ ID [PK]
Name
}
修改数据存放位置示例代码
步骤 1:找到 MySQL 配置文件
在 MySQL 安装目录下找到 "my.ini" 文件。
步骤 2:修改配置文件
使用文本编辑器打开 "my.ini" 文件,并找到以下两行配置:
datadir=C:/ProgramData/MySQL/MySQL Server x.x/Data
log-error=C:/ProgramData/MySQL/MySQL Server x.x/Data/error.log
将上述路径改为自定义的存放路径,例如:
datadir=D:/MySQL/Data
log-error=D:/MySQL/Data/error.log
步骤 3:重启 MySQL 服务
保存修改后的配置文件,并重启 MySQL 服务,使配置生效。
通过上述示例,可以看到如何修改 MySQL 数据存放位置,并且使用 Markdown 和 Mermaid 语法绘制了一个关系图。
## 结尾
本文介绍了 Windows 系统下 MySQL 数据存放位置的相关知识,并提供了修改数据存放位置的示例代码。通过合理地配置数据存放位置,可以提高数据库的性能和可靠性,同时方便进行数据库的备份和恢复操作。希望本文对你理解和使用 MySQL 有所帮助!